How Montchanin’s Landscape Impacts Tree Health

Montchanin’s topography and soil composition create both beauty and challenges for tree preservation. Rolling hills, clay-heavy soils, and varied moisture levels mean that trees in this area often experience inconsistent growing conditions. Historic development and increased urbanization can also lead to compacted root zones, reduced air circulation, and excess surface runoff. These factors place trees under chronic stress, weakening their natural defenses and making them more vulnerable to pathogens like bacterial leaf scorch, verticillium wilt, and Phytophthora root rot.

Additionally, Delaware’s humid mid-Atlantic climate fosters the spread of fungal diseases like anthracnose and powdery mildew, while pests like scale insects, emerald ash borers, and spider mites thrive in weakened canopies. A healthy-looking tree today could be hiding the early stages of decline unless a professional assessment is conducted.

Understanding the Warning Signs Before It’s Too Late

Many homeowners mistake the initial signs of disease for seasonal change or environmental variability. But in truth, subtle shifts—such as delayed leaf-out, premature leaf loss, branch dieback, or sap weeping from the trunk—can point to infections or infestations already underway. Common issues in Montchanin include:

  • Black spot on maples or cherry trees

  • Shot hole disease in ornamental plums

  • Fungal conks at the base of trunks, indicating internal decay

  • Insect exit holes or sawdust trails beneath bark

These are not cosmetic problems—they are signals that your tree’s internal systems are under attack. Acting early can mean the difference between a targeted treatment plan and full removal.

What a Professional Tree Disease Diagnosis Involves

Every tree species reacts differently to disease, and that’s why a one-size-fits-all treatment doesn’t work. ISA-certified arborists begin with a full site inspection that considers not just the tree itself, but also the surrounding plant life, soil composition, drainage, and exposure to pollutants or mechanical damage. The evaluation includes canopy condition, leaf texture, bark abnormalities, root flare integrity, and pest activity.

Lab testing may be used when pathogens are suspected but not visibly obvious. Once the diagnosis is made, a treatment plan is customized using the most effective, least invasive methods available. These might include systemic fungicides, soil amendment protocols, deep root feeding, pruning for airflow, or the introduction of beneficial microbes to restore healthy soil biology.

Restorative Treatment Options That Prioritize Long-Term Health

The goal is never just to stop the disease—it’s to strengthen the tree’s immune system, reverse decline, and prevent future outbreaks. Treatment strategies are selected based on timing, severity, species, and the unique conditions of your Montchanin property. In many cases, environmental correction (like addressing compaction or adjusting irrigation) is just as vital as the application of any treatment.

Integrated Pest Management (IPM) techniques are often used to address pest-induced disease. For instance, rather than applying chemical sprays indiscriminately, targeted soil injections or trunk applications are used to eliminate the problem with minimal impact on the surrounding ecosystem. Preventative Care Tips for Montchanin Property Owners

Preventing tree disease begins with proactive care. Homeowners can extend the life and health of their trees by:

  • Scheduling routine health assessments at least once per year

  • Avoiding over-mulching, which can suffocate root systems

  • Ensuring proper pruning to promote airflow and reduce moisture retention

  • Watering deeply during drought periods instead of shallow, frequent watering

  • Noticing and reporting early changes in foliage, bark, or growth behavior

Remember, early intervention is always more effective—and less costly—than emergency removal or replacement.
